On December 27, the design plan for the Mingjing Group Headquarters Building project on Plot No. [2024]86 of the Hangzhou Municipal Government’s Land Reserve was made public in Jianghai New City, Qiantang District, Hangzhou, adding another headquarters building to the core area of Dajiangdong.

The Mingjing Group Headquarters Building project is located on Plot QT080402-14 within the Jianghai City Unit, bounded by Plot QT080402-14-1 to the east, the planned Xiangmin Road to the south, the planned Qingxi Second Road to the west, and the green belt along Jiangdong Avenue to the north.

The project has a total investment of RMB 520 million, occupies a land area of 15,344 square meters, and features a total floor area of 68,408 square meters, including 46,032 square meters above ground and 22,376 square meters underground. The master plan calls for a 23-story headquarters office building, an 11-story hotel, and commercial and ancillary facilities spanning 2 to 4 floors. Construction is scheduled to take place from 2024 to 2027.

The project was designed by the Zhejiang Provincial Academy of Architectural Design. The main building comprises 23 floors, with a maximum height of 127 meters at the top structural frame. The façade features diamond-shaped diagonal bracing, while the roof is cut in a crystalline pattern, resulting in a striking and innovative form that echoes the iconic Bank of China Tower in Hong Kong.

Zhejiang Mingjing Holding Group Co., Ltd. was founded in 2005 and is a diversified, comprehensive enterprise integrating construction engineering, municipal engineering, interior decoration, landscape engineering, and real estate development. The group’s headquarters is located at No. 18 Yiqian East Street, Yipeng Subdistrict, on the south bank of the Qiantang River. In August 2024, one of its subsidiaries successfully acquired Plot QT080402-14 in the Jianghai City development zone to construct a headquarters building.

Coincidentally, the eastern parcel of the Mingjing Group Headquarters Building project—plot QT080402-14-1—was also put up for sale in November, with Hangzhou Fengling Real Estate Co., Ltd. emerging as the winning bidder. The plot is zoned for a maximum building height of 150 meters, matching the current tallest building in Dajiangdong, Smart Valley Tower 1, and together they will help define a brand-new skyline for Jianghai New City.

The Qiantang District’s Core River–Sea City is committed to developing a comprehensive business district that integrates headquarters offices, specialized services, business amenities, dining, and leisure facilities. Along Metro Line 8, multiple TOD clusters are planned, with the Innovation and Entrepreneurship Service Cluster at Qingxi Third Road Station and the Public Services and Business Headquarters Cluster at Qingliu Middle Road Station situated in the core area of the new city.


Qingxi Third Road TOD
The Mingjing Group Headquarters Building project is located north of the TOD area along Qingxi Third Road. In April 2024, Qiantang District issued an international public call for conceptual design proposals for the north–south twin towers and associated parcels within the Qingxi Third Road TOD zone, with the twin towers capped at a height of 135 meters, thereby adding two additional super-tall buildings to the area.

According to the master plan, the tallest buildings in Jianghai New City will be located at the Qingliu Middle Road TOD site, with the two core twin towers both exceeding the 150-meter height of Wisdom Valley. As more headquarters buildings are developed and completed, the Jiangdong area is poised to establish a brand-new, district-level urban skyline for Hangzhou.
